Episode 61: “Because I want to” is a reason (and might be the *best* reason)

I talk to a lot of people who are in the process of figuring out what they want. There's often one thing that I’m listening for — or feeling for — in those conversations, and that is: “because I want to.”

So in this podcast episode, I clarify what I mean by this and share why this is helpful + address some of the objections I suspect you’re probably already having.

I share a client story and a personal story + end with a mini FAQ where I answer questions like, “what if I can’t find my ‘because I want to?’”

I hope this episode helps you find clarity if you don't yet have it (or gives you the courage to find your own "because I want to".)
